MIF_E31221247/resources/views/admin/stunting.blade.php

236 lines
15 KiB
PHP

@extends('admin.layout.main', ['title' => 'Data Stunting'])
@section('main')
<div class="page-heading">
<h3>Kriteria Ideal(Tidak Stunting)</h3>
</div>
<div class="card">
<div class="card-header d-flex justify-content-between">
<h5>Tambahkan Kriteria anak ideal tidak stunting</h5>
<div class="dropdown">
<div>
{{-- <button class="btn btn-secondary dropdown-toggle btn-sm" type="button" data-bs-toggle="dropdown"
aria-expanded="false">
Export
</button> --}}
<ul class="dropdown-menu border">
<li><a class="dropdown-item" href="export-penyakit-pdf">Export PDF</a></li>
<li><a class="dropdown-item" href="export-penyakit-excel">Export Excel</a></li>
</ul>
<button class="btn btn-primary btn-sm" type="button" data-bs-toggle="modal"
data-bs-target="#tambah">+</button>
</div>
</div>
</div>
{{-- modal tambah data --}}
<div class="modal fade" id="tambah" tabindex="-1" aria-labelledby="exampleModalLabel" aria-hidden="true">
<div class="modal-dialog modal-dialog-centered">
<div class="modal-content">
<form action="{{ url('data-stunting') }}" method="POST">
@csrf
<div class="modal-header">
<h1 class="modal-title fs-5" id="exampleModalLabel">Tambah Kriteria Ideal</h1>
<button type="button" class="btn-close" data-bs-dismiss="modal" aria-label="Close"></button>
</div>
<div class="modal-body">
<div class="mb-3">
<div class="mb-3">
<label for="penyakit-form" class="form-label">Umur</label>
<div class="d-flex gap-2">
<input type="number" class="form-control" min="0" name="dari_umur"
placeholder="Dari" id="penyakit-form" required>
<p class="mt-3">s/d</p>
<input type="number" class="form-control" min="0" name="sampai_umur"
placeholder="Sampai" required id="penyakit-form">
</div>
</div>
<div class="mb-3">
<label for="penyakit-form" class="form-label">Berat Badan</label>
<div class="d-flex gap-2">
<input type="number" class="form-control" min="0" name="dari_berat"
placeholder="Dari" id="penyakit-form" required>
<p class="mt-3">s/d</p>
<input type="number" class="form-control" min="0" name="sampai_berat"
placeholder="Sampai" required id="penyakit-form">
</div>
</div>
<div class="mb-3">
<label for="penyakit-form" class="form-label">Tinggi Badan</label>
<div class="d-flex gap-2">
<input type="number" class="form-control" min="0" name="dari_tinggi"
placeholder="Dari" id="penyakit-form" required>
<p class="mt-3">s/d</p>
<input type="number" class="form-control" min="0" name="sampai_tinggi"
placeholder="Sampai" required id="penyakit-form">
</div>
</div>
</div>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-secondary" data-bs-dismiss="modal">Close</button>
<button type="submit" class="btn btn-primary">Save changes</button>
</div>
</form>
</div>
</div>
</div>
{{-- End modal tambah --}}
<div class="card-body">
<div class="mb-3">
<input type="search" class="form-control" id="myInput" onkeyup="myFunction()" placeholder="Pencarian...">
</div>
<div class="table-responsive">
<table class="table" id="myTable">
<thead>
<tr>
<th scope="col">No</th>
<th scope="col">Umur</th>
<th scope="col">Berat Badan</th>
<th scope="col">Tinggi Badan</th>
<th scope="col">Aksi</th>
</tr>
</thead>
<tbody>
@forelse ($stunting as $item)
<tr>
<td>{{ $loop->iteration }}</td>
<td>{{ $item->dari_umur . ' sampai ' . $item->sampai_umur }}</td>
<td>{{ $item->dari_berat . ' sampai ' . $item->sampai_berat }}</td>
<td>{{ $item->dari_tinggi . ' sampai ' . $item->sampai_tinggi }}</td>
<td class="d-flex gap-2">
<button type="button" class="btn btn-primary btn-sm" data-bs-toggle="modal"
data-bs-target="#edit{{ $item->id }}">
Edit
</button>
<button type="button" class="btn btn-danger btn-sm" data-bs-toggle="modal"
data-bs-target="#delete{{ $item->id }}">
Delete
</button>
</td>
</tr>
{{-- modal edit stunting --}}
<div class="modal fade" id="edit{{ $item->id }}" tabindex="-1"
aria-labelledby="exampleModalLabel" aria-hidden="true">
<div class="modal-dialog modal-dialog-centered">
<div class="modal-content">
<form action="{{ url('data-stunting/' . $item->id) }}" method="POST">
@csrf
@method('put')
<div class="modal-header">
<h1 class="modal-title fs-5" id="exampleModalLabel">Tambah Ideal
</h1>
<button type="button" class="btn-close" data-bs-dismiss="modal"
aria-label="Close"></button>
</div>
<div class="modal-body">
<div class="mb-3">
<div class="mb-3">
<label for="penyakit-form" class="form-label">Umur</label>
<div class="d-flex gap-2">
<input type="number" class="form-control" min="0"
name="dari_umur" placeholder="Dari" id="penyakit-form"
required value="{{ $item->dari_umur }}">
<p class="mt-3">s/d</p>
<input type="number" class="form-control" min="0"
name="sampai_umur" placeholder="Sampai" required
id="penyakit-form" value="{{ $item->sampai_umur }}">
</div>
</div>
<div class="mb-3">
<label for="penyakit-form" class="form-label">Berat Badan</label>
<div class="d-flex gap-2">
<input type="number" class="form-control" min="0"
value="{{ $item->dari_berat }}" name="dari_berat"
placeholder="Dari" id="penyakit-form" required>
<p class="mt-3">s/d</p>
<input type="number" class="form-control" min="0"
name="sampai_berat" placeholder="Sampai" required
id="penyakit-form" value="{{ $item->sampai_berat }}">
</div>
</div>
<div class="mb-3">
<label for="penyakit-form" class="form-label">Tinggi Badan</label>
<div class="d-flex gap-2">
<input type="number" class="form-control" min="0"
value="{{ $item->dari_tinggi }}" name="dari_tinggi"
placeholder="Dari" id="penyakit-form" required>
<p class="mt-3">s/d</p>
<input type="number" class="form-control" min="0"
value="{{ $item->sampai_tinggi }}" name="sampai_tinggi"
placeholder="Sampai" required id="penyakit-form">
</div>
</div>
</div>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-secondary"
data-bs-dismiss="modal">Close</button>
<button type="submit" class="btn btn-primary">Save changes</button>
</div>
</form>
</div>
</div>
</div>
{{-- end modal edit stunting --}}
<!-- Modal delete -->
<div class="modal fade" id="delete{{ $item->id }}" tabindex="-1"
aria-labelledby="exampleModalLabel" aria-hidden="true">
<div class="modal-dialog modal-dialog-centered">
<div class="modal-content">
<button type="button" class="btn-close m-2 ms-auto" data-bs-dismiss="modal"
aria-label="Close"></button>
<div class="modal-body">
<h1 class="text-center fw-bold">DELETE</h1>
<h4 class="text-center mb-3">Yakin data akan dihapus?</h4>
<form action="{{ url('data-stunting/' . $item->id) }}" method="POST">
@csrf
<input type="hidden" name="_method" value="DELETE">
<div class="d-grid gap-2 col-4 mx-auto d-flex">
<button type="button" class="btn btn-secondary"
data-bs-dismiss="modal">Batal</button>
<button type="submit" class="btn btn-danger"><i
class="fa-solid fa-trash text-white me-1"></i>Delete</button>
</div>
</form>
</div>
</div>
</div>
</div>
{{-- end delete model --}}
@empty
<td colspan="5" class="text-center">Tidak ada data tersedia</td>
@endforelse
</tbody>
</table>
</div>
</div>
</div>
<script>
function myFunction() {
var input, filter, table, tr, td, i, txtValue;
input = document.getElementById("myInput");
filter = input.value.toUpperCase();
table = document.getElementById("myTable");
tr = table.getElementsByTagName("tr");
for (i = 0; i < tr.length; i++) {
td = tr[i].getElementsByTagName("td");
for (var j = 0; j < td.length; j++) {
txtValue = td[j].textContent || td[j].innerText;
if (txtValue.toUpperCase().indexOf(filter) > -1) {
tr[i].style.display = "";
break;
} else {
tr[i].style.display = "none";
}
}
}
}
</script>
@endsection